Life for Celtic supporters over the last 12 months has been pretty good, for those stationed in Australia it must be dream-like.

After the miseries of Lockdown and the most barren of seasons, supporters down under are now swamped with news about their club as the Australian media take a shine to their club.

Not only that but for the first time in more than a decade Celtic will be playing in Australia with their Aussie raised manager, Ange Postecoglou the star of the show.

Eighteen months ago the occasional mention of Tom Rogic would surface in Australia but his career seemed to be winding down but the arrival of a former Socceroos manager has put the club in a very different light.

Over the last few days Postecoglou has been all over the Australian media, next time he is back in town he’ll have his title winning squad with him and the backing of thousands of Australian Celtic fans.
